Course Details

Introduction to Hydroponics: Defining hydroponics, its history, and advantages.
Hydroponic Systems: Overview of different types of hydroponic systems.
Plant Nutrients: Explanation of macro and micronutrients, nutrient management, and pH balance.
Grow Mediums: Comparison of various grow mediums and their properties.
Lighting Systems: Introduction to artificial lighting, spectral quality, and photoperiod.
System Design and Construction: Design considerations, materials, and construction techniques.
Crop Selection and Planning: Choosing crops, crop cycles, and yield projections.
Monitoring and Control: Sensors, data acquisition, and automation.
Sustainable Practices: Water and energy efficiency, waste reduction, and closed-loop systems.
Economics of Hydroponics: Market analysis, financial planning, and business models.

Career Path

The hydroponics industry is booming, offering diverse career opportunities in the UK. This 3D pie chart showcases the distribution of roles in this growing field. 1. **Hydroponic Engineer (30%)** - These professionals design, build, and maintain hydroponic systems, ensuring optimal plant growth. A strong background in engineering, botany, and automation is essential. 2. **Hydroponic Technician (25%)** - Technicians operate and manage hydroponic systems, monitor plant growth, and troubleshoot issues. A combination of hands-on skills and botanical knowledge is required. 3. **System Designer (20%)** - Designers create efficient and sustainable hydroponic system layouts, integrating technology and plant growth needs. A blend of design, engineering, and horticultural expertise is beneficial. 4. **Consultant (15%)** - Consultants advise businesses and individuals on hydroponic systems, providing recommendations on design, implementation, and maintenance. Strong communication and problem-solving skills are crucial. 5. **Educator (10%)** - Educators teach hydroponics principles, techniques, and applications in academic or vocational settings. A solid understanding of hydroponics and teaching experience are necessary.
